How to Choose a Warehouse Racking System

When choosing a warehouse racking system, there are several factors you should consider including size, capacity, weight capacity, access control requirements, fire safety requirements, ease of installation/maintenance/removal, durability/lifespan, cost-effectiveness, and aesthetics (if relevant). You should also consider whether adjustable shelves or static shelves are best suited for your needs. Types of Warehouse Racks  

There are several different types of warehouse racks available including cantilever racks (for storing long items), drive-in racks (for bulk storage), pallet flow racks (for FIFO inventory rotation), pushback racks (for storing bulky items) mobile shelving units (for easy access), mezzanine systems (for creating additional storage levels), pick modules(for optimizing order picking operations),flow-through pallet rack systems (for increasing efficiency in shipping/receiving areas), and more!  Each type has its own advantages depending on its intended use so it’s important to assess each type carefully before making a decision about which one is best suited for your needs.
